Average Temperature

• January to March: 11.87°C during the day, 7.8°C at night

• April to June: 22.8°C during the day, 16.87°C at night

• July to September: 28.88°C during the day, 22.69°C at night

• October to December: 16.38°C during the day, 12.13°C at night
